Kelleher International is a high end dating service that specializes in match making for athletes. Their clients include Terrell Owens and sports executives. In fact, 20% of Kelleher International clients are former or current athletes.
Kelleher International understands that athletes have no problems going out on dates but focuses on finding soul mates. But finding your all-star will come at a price, Kelleher International charges between $25,000 to $150,000 for their services.
But you can’t put a price on love… according to Kelleher International co-owner Amber Kelleher-Andrews, “A client once told me $100,000 is nothing. He’d just spent $4 million on his divorce.”
There is a new diva form the LA Lakers who is said to be joining the cast of the Real Housewives of Beverly Hill, and it’s not Kobe Bryant. Though Bravo has not confirmed a second season, they are looking to add to their cast, with Jeanie Buss is rumored to be the front runner.
Buss is the executive vice president of business operations for the Lakers and the daughter of owner Jerry Buss. To add a jersey chaser twist, Buss is dating Lakers head coach Phil Jackson.
Adrienne Maloof-Nassif is already a fan favorite on the show and is co-owner of the Sacramento Kings.
